In a meeting 70 % of the members favour and 30 % oppose a certain proposal. A member is selected at random. We take X =0 if he opposed the proposal and we take X =1 , if the member is in favour. Then variance of X is

Step-by-step solution
Random variable definition. Let X represent the outcome of selecting a member, where X = 0 indicates opposition and X = 1 indicates support for the proposal. Given probabilities: P(X = 0) = 0.3 , P(X = 1) = 0.7 . X follows a Bernoulli distribution with parameter p = 0.7 . Variance computation. For a Bernoulli random variable, the variance is Var (X) = p(1 - p) = 0.7 0.3 = 0.21 . 0.21 expressed as a fraction is 21 100 , matching option C. Final answer: C
